GENERAL PURPOSE OF JOB

Utilizing sophisticated computer aided imaging equipment, performs quality magnetic resonance imaging to create images for diagnosis. The MRI technologist integrates scientific knowledge and technical skills with effective patient interaction to provide quality patient focused care and useful diagnostic information The MRI Technologist will perform other duties as deemed necessary.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Maintains utmost level of confidentiality at all times.
  • Adheres to hospital policies and procedures.
  • Demonstrates business practices and personal actions that are ethical and adhere to corporate compliance and integrity guidelines.
  • Demonstrate an understanding of human cross-sectional anatomy, physiology, pharmacology and medical terminology
  • Maintains a high degree of accuracy in positioning and image formation
  • Maintains knowledge of magnetic field safety
  • Prepares and administers contrast media (gadolinium) in accordance with DCH medication guidelines and physician order
  • Serves as the primary liaison between patients/families and radiologists and other members of the support team
  • Is sensitive to the physical and emotional needs of the patients/families through good communication, patient assessment, patient monitoring and patient care skills
  • Uses professional and ethical judgment and critical thinking in performance of duties
  • Participates in MR QA programs to continually assess professional performance
  • Pursues continuing education activities to for optimal patient care, enhanced knowledge and technical competence
  • Maintains a high degree of accuracy in positioning and exposure techniques
  • Maintains knowledge of and practices proper magnetic and patient safety techniques. Maintains sensitivity to the mental and physical needs of the patient through good communication, patient assessment, patient monitoring and patient care skills
  • Reconfirms patient identification and verifies procedure requested or prescribed
  • Uses good age specific skills in dealing with the psychosocial, developmental and physical needs of the patient
  • Uses consistent and appropriate techniques to gather relevant information from the medical record, patient, family and other healthcare providers
  • Verifies patient LMP status when appropriate
  • Determines whether the patient has been appropriately prepared for the examination
  • Assesses factors that may contraindicate the requested procedure, such as medication, insufficient preparation, presence of ferrous and RF-sensitive material before patient enters the magnetic field
  • Analysis information obtained during the assessment phase and develops an action plan for completing the procedure
  • Uses his/her professional judgment to adapt imaging procedures to improve diagnostic quality
  • Consults appropriate medical personnel to determine a modified action plan when necessary
  • Determines the need for accessory equipment
  • Reviews the medical record and the physician’s request to determine optimal scanning parameters for suspected pathology
  • Verifies that the patient/family have consented to the procedure and fully understands any risks, benefits, alternatives and follow-up. When appropriate, verifies that written consent has been obtained
  • Provides accurate explanations and instructions at an appropriate time and at a level the patient/family can understand
  • Administers first aid and provides life support in emergency situations
  • Assesses the patient’s physical and mental status during the procedure
  • Measures the procedure against established protocols and guidelines
  • Identifies any exceptions to the expected outcome
  • Documents any exceptions clearly and accurately
  • Reviews images to determine if additional scans will enhance the diagnostic value of the procedure
  • Notifies appropriate health provider when immediate clinical response is necessary, based on procedural findings and patient condition
  • Reassess the patient’s mental and physical status prior to discharge from the practitioner’s care
  • Transfers images to PACS system as appropriate
  • Archives images to data storage devices according to established guidelines
  • Reviews all diagnostic data for completeness and accuracy
  • Ensures that all procedural requirements are in place to achieve a quality diagnostic exam
  • Refers questions about diagnosis, prognosis or treatment to the patient’s physician.

EDUCATION AND/OR EXPERIENCE
  • Associate's degree (A. A.) or equivalent from a two-year college or technical school.
  • Two to four years related experience and/or training in magnetic resonance imaging or equivalent combination of education and experience.
CERTIFICATES,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S
  • Registered MR Technologist – American Registry of Radiologic Technologists in Magnetic Resonance Imaging (ARRT-M) or American Registry of Magnetic Resonance Imaging Technologists (ARMRIT)
  • Registered with the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ists as a Registered Radiologic Technologist (RT-R) if performing radiography
  • Current unlimited license with the Texas Medical Board as a Certified Medical Radiologic Technologist (CMRT) if performing radiography
  • Current CPR Certification

Until all children are well. Driscoll Children’s Hospital and its specialty centers, urgent care centers, and after-hours facility serve a vast area covering 31 South Texas counties. The hospital is a 191-bed tertiary care center offering 32 medical and 13 surgical specialties.
